British film icon Sir Michael Caine has abandoned his support of the Labour party and announced he will vote Conservative at the next general election.
The actor, 76, a former Labour supporter, condemned the terrible state that has been allowed to develop in Britain and said he planned to change his allegiance at the next election.
For his latest film, Harry Brown, about violence on Britains streets, Sir Michael spent time with a gang from a tough inner London estate, who were hired as extras.
